Cecconi Simone created this unit in a townhouse neighborhood in Toronto, Canada.
Undertaking description
The model for “Trinity Bellwoods Town + Homes” showcases contemporary interior style, imparting a progressive brand identity to this urban-infill undertaking in a marketplace segment crowded with retrograde developments.
Cecconi Simone conceived the interiors and customized fixtures for the 3 unit kinds inside of the neighborhood – 4.one meter-broad, 4.6 meter-wide and 5.8 meter-wide. The ground degree and third floor of the 4.6 meter unit are represented in the model, in a clean palette of white, black, walnut and yellow.
Customized millwork, with alternating closed and open storage, spans the total length of the ground level, generating a constant, horizontal composition of solids and voids. The stair, kitchen island tower and integrated exhaust hood introduce modulating aspects of verticality.
Subtle millwork particulars in the kitchen incorporate zero-edge Corian counters, a slotted shelf for standing dishes, back-painted seamless backsplash and integrated appliances. A developed-in bench in the dining location is complemented by an integrated ledge in the residing area, both with storage beneath.
The master suite functions a custom walnut-laminate rest unit, incorporating a bed, side tables, sofa and show niches with LEDs. The ensuite is made up of a specially-made vanity with integrated white Corian sinks, counter and backsplash and open and closed storage cabinets in white and walnut laminate. Custom wall-mounted medicine cabinets are accessed by way of a pivoting mirror.
